One of the main contradictions in Arab-China business relations lies in the balance between economic opportunities and political considerations. Arab countries, rich in natural resources, have sought to attract Chinese investment and trade to fuel their development and diversify their economies. At the same time, they must navigate issues such as human rights concerns and political instability, which can create tensions with China's non-interference policy in domestic affairs. Cultural differences also present a challenge in Arab-China business relations. While both regions have deep-rooted historical and cultural heritage, differences in business practices, communication styles, and customs can hinder effective collaboration. Understanding and respecting these differences is crucial for building trust and fostering successful partnerships. Furthermore, the varying priorities and development strategies of Arab countries and China can lead to conflicting interests. Arab countries may prioritize infrastructure development, renewable energy, and tourism, while China may focus on technology transfer, industrial cooperation, and market access. Finding common ground and aligning goals will be essential for mutually beneficial business outcomes. Despite these contradictions, there are opportunities for Arab countries and China to strengthen their economic relations. By promoting dialogue, enhancing cultural exchanges, and building mutual trust, both regions can overcome challenges and work towards sustainable and inclusive economic growth. Overall, the Arab-China business relationship showcases a complex interplay of cooperation and contradictions.
